Building a Custom Stone Outdoor Grill: A Comprehensive Guide

A custom stone outdoor grill offers a unique and stylish addition to any backyard. It's more than just a cooking appliance; it's a statement piece that reflects your personal style and creates a focal point for entertaining. This guide provides a comprehensive overview of the process, from design considerations to construction techniques.

Designing the Grill

The first step in building a custom stone outdoor grill is to meticulously plan its design. This involves considering factors such as size, shape, and features.

  • Size: Determine the grill's footprint based on the size of your outdoor space and your typical cooking needs. Consider the number of people you usually entertain and the types of dishes you plan to prepare.
  • Shape: Rectangular grills are the most common, but you can opt for round, oval, or even more unique shapes. Consider your preferences and the overall aesthetic of your patio or backyard.
  • Features: Decide on features that enhance functionality and usability, such as side tables, warming shelves, wood storage, and built-in seating.
  • Style: Research various stone styles and choose one that complements your home's architecture and your personal taste. Some popular options include natural stone, brick, and manufactured stone.

It's helpful to sketch out your design ideas and experiment with different layouts. You can also use online design tools or consult with a landscape architect or professional builder for guidance.

Constructing the Grill

Once you have a detailed plan, you can start constructing the grill. This involves several steps, including:

  • Foundation: Lay a solid foundation using concrete or patio blocks. Ensure it's level and can support the weight of the grill.
  • Framing: Build a sturdy frame using steel or concrete blocks for the grill's structure. This will hold the firebox and cooking surface.
  • Firebox: Construct the firebox using refractory bricks or concrete blocks designed for high heat. It should be large enough to accommodate the desired heat output and cooking space. Install a fire grate and a chimney for proper airflow.
  • Cooking Surface: Choose a suitable cooking surface, such as cast iron grates, lava rock, or ceramic tiles. Ensure it's heat-resistant and durable.
  • Stonework: Finally, build the exterior of the grill using your chosen stone. Carefully lay each stone to create a smooth and aesthetically pleasing finish.

It's crucial to follow safety guidelines, wearing appropriate safety gear and ensuring the grill is properly ventilated during construction. Consult with a professional if you're unsure about any of the steps or if you're unfamiliar with construction techniques.

Choosing the Right Materials

The choice of materials plays a crucial role in the durability and longevity of your custom stone outdoor grill. Consider the following factors:

  • Stone Type: Opt for a stone that can withstand high temperatures and outdoor elements. Slate, granite, limestone, and sandstone are common choices. Ensure you select a type that can handle the thermal expansion and contraction associated with high heat.
  • Mortar: Use a high-temperature mortar specifically designed for outdoor applications. It should be strong enough to bind the stones together and resist cracking under heat.
  • Refractory Materials: Choose firebrick or refractory concrete for the firebox. These materials can withstand intense heat and prevent the structure from deteriorating.
  • Cooking Surface: Select cast iron grates or a heat-resistant material for the cooking surface that provides even heat distribution and prevents warping.

Research and compare different materials, considering their properties, availability, and cost before making your final selection. It's also wise to consult with a masonry expert for their recommendations based on your specific design and location.
